Forshaw v Qantas Airways Limited [2023] FCA 957 File number: VID 632 of 2022
Judgment of: SNADEN J
Date of judgment: 16 August 2023
Catchwords: PRACTICE AND PROCEDURE – interlocutory application to strike out amended statement of claim or parts thereof – principles to be applied – whether allegation concerning a "workplace culture" is impermissibly vague – whether allegation about the creation of, tolerance of, or failure to prevent a state of affairs by a body corporate is conclusory – whether s 361(1) of the Fair Work Act 2009 (Cth) operates to relieve an applicant of the need to identify the human agents responsible for corporate conduct – whether allegations about corporate conduct and state of mind are likely to cause prejudice, embarrassment or delay – interlocutory application allowed in part
Legislation: Fair Work Act 2009 (Cth) pt 3-1, ss 340, 342, 351, 361, 793 Federal Court Rules 2011 rr 16.03(2), 16.21
Cases cited: Construction, Forestry, Mining and Energy Union v BHP Coal Pty Ltd [2017] FCAFC 50 Construction, Forestry, Mining and Energy Union v Coal and Allied Operations Pty Ltd (1999) 140 IR 131 Davids Distribution Pty Ltd v National Union of Workers (1999) 91 FCR 463 Harvey v Dioceses of Sale Catholic Education Ltd (St Joseph's Primary School Wonthaggi) (No 2) [2021] FCA 1102 Takemoto v Moody's Investors Service Pty Limited [2014] FCA 1081 TechnologyOne Ltd v Roohizadegan (2021) 174 ALD 224 Weddall v Rasier Pacific Pty Ltd [2023] FCA 59 White Industries v Federal Commissioner of Taxation (2007) 160 FCR 298
